Becoming an e-commerce architect: 12 API integration skills for developers
Blog post from Postman
Mike Sedzielewski, co-founder of Voucherify, shares insights on the impact of APIs in transforming e-commerce projects and their role in Voucherify's evolution into a trusted, API-first promotion and loyalty engine over its 10-year journey. Initially contracted to migrate a client's MVP from Google Sheets to a comprehensive CRM using Salesforce, the team learned the power of headless architecture and the importance of integrating multiple third-party APIs, despite early challenges with data synchronization. As APIs have become mainstream, Sedzielewski emphasizes mastering key aspects such as reading API documentation, understanding versioning, ensuring data integrity with idempotent endpoints, handling errors, managing rate limits, and utilizing webhooks and pre-built integrations to enhance efficiency and reliability. He highlights the significance of tools like Customer Data Platforms (CDPs) for managing data security and privacy and advises on monitoring for downtime and considering event-driven architecture for scaling systems. Ultimately, the narrative underscores the importance of embracing APIs as a craft essential to the digital backbone of modern businesses, encouraging developers to continually innovate and experiment in the evolving e-commerce landscape.
